Property Description
Nestled at the base of the San Bernardino National Forest, the site is part of the Running Springs Mountain community. As the gateway to the mountain communities of Lake Arrowhead, Arrowbear, Green Valley Lake, and Big Bear, this is the closest community to Snow Valley Mountain Resort. Resting at +/-6,000 feet above sea level, this 67.98-acre parcel is only a short drive to Orange County, Los Angeles, and San Diego counties. With electrical, water, and sewer already on site and multiple access points off of Fredalba Road, this is a rare opportunity to acquire a developable Mountain Parcel with limitless possibilities. Zoned as Hilltop/Special Development-Residential (HT/SD-RES), a tentative tract map (TTM 7447) was previously prepared with 155 Single-family lots. This is also an ideal site for recreational uses such as large lot estates, retreat/conference facilities and even glamping/RV/campsites. Nestled among majestic pine, oak, and cedar trees, and featuring a 9/10-month running stream, the land offers both breathtaking city light views and peaceful wooded escapes. Zoned Special Development Residential (SD-RES) with overlay districts, this parcel opens a world of flexible possibilities.
